It was delivery by air.
On Monday s The Ellen DeGeneres Show , the host welcomes new mom Lavi Mounga of Utah, a woman who recently gave birth while on a plane flight.

Mounga, unaware she was even pregnant, describes going to the bathroom feeling like she had cramps, only to discover she was having contractions.
Thankfully, also on the flight were Dr. Dale Glenn, nurses Lani Bamfield, Amanda Beeding, Mimi Ho, and physician assistant Lindsay Maughan, who all helped deliver the baby safe and healthy.

Sydney Page Lavi Mounga, 38, with physician Dale Glenn, 52, after she unexpectedly gave birth to her son, Raymond, on a Delta flight from Salt Lake City to Honolulu. Mounga did not know she was pregnant. (Hawaii Pacific Health) Dale Glenn was dozing off on a Delta flight from Salt Lake City to Honolulu last week when his 19-year-old daughter abruptly elbowed him. “Dad, they’re calling for a doctor,” she said urgently. About halfway through the six-hour flight, Glenn swiftly sprung out of his seat.
